MS-DRG 69 – Transient Ischemia without Thrombolytic
A Medical DRG in MDC 01 (Diseases & Disorders of the Nervous System). Inpatient cases group to DRG 69 when the ICD-10-CM principal diagnosis is one of the 13 codes listed below. Its FY 2026 relative weight is 0.7988 with a geometric mean length of stay of 2.0 days.
The grouper first assigns the case to MDC 01 from the principal diagnosis and finds no qualifying operating-room procedure (this is a Medical DRG; ICD-10-PCS codes do not drive assignment here).

What is the relative weight of DRG 69?
The FY 2026 relative weight of this DRG is 0.7988, meaning reimbursement of roughly 0.80 times the average Medicare inpatient case. Multiply by a hospital's blended base rate for the approximate payment.
